Where does “არიკი” come from?

არიკი (Mingrelian) comes from Armenian առակ, from Old Armenian առակ, from Old Armenian առ, from Old Armenian առնում, from Proto-Indo-European h₂r-nu-, from Proto-Indo-European h₂er- — to fit, to fix, to put together.

არიკი (Mingrelian): tale
